Mesothelioma is a rare, fatal cancer that can be found in the chest cavity's lining the lungs, heart or abdomen. Asbestos exposure is the only known cause of mesothelioma. The cancer is often diagnosed years after the initial exposure. Asbestos sufferers may pursue financial compensation through a lawsuit or a trust fund claim.
Companies that have declared bankruptcy due to asbestos litigation have set up asbestos trust funds. The funds provide victims with compensation, without the need to go through a lengthy trial.

Fees
A mesothelioma diagnosis can be a source of stress for the family members of a patient. It can also cause financial difficulties due to the high cost of treatment and the loss of income. A lawsuit may seek compensation to help victims recover and pay for living expenses and treatment. Families can also make wrongful death claims in the event that loved ones have died from mesothelioma.
A mesothelioma attorney can discuss the legal options for the client's situation and assist them in understanding the potential benefits from their case. Mesothelioma lawyers typically charge a contingency cost, which means they are only paid if they obtain a settlement or verdict for their client's case. However, the fees differ based on the law firm and the complexity of a case is.
Most mesothelioma law firms provide a free evaluation of your case. They will also outline how they bill their clients for their services, and what the difference is between the costs they are accountable for (such as photocopies and court filing fees) and attorney fees that are determined by the nature of the case.
